Huobazi Seafood Snack Booth is located in Deyang, China on 96245C3, Dashu E Rd, Mianzhu. Huobazi Seafood Snack Booth is rated 3 out of 5 in the category seafood restaurant in China.
Address
96245C3, Dashu E Rd, Mianzhu
Service options
TakeawayDine-in
Amenities
Good for kidsToilets